How far is Greenwood from Perth’s central business district?
Greenwood is located about 18 km north of Perth’s CBD, making it a convenient commute while enjoying a suburban lifestyle.
Which public transport options are available near the home?
Greenwood is served by Transperth bus routes 445, 446, 447 and 344, and the Greenwood railway station provides rail access to the city. The suburb is also bordered by Warwick Road and Hepburn Avenue, which connect to the Mitchell Freeway.
What shopping centres are close to 41 Elmhurst Way?
The main Greenwood Village Shopping Centre on Calectasia Street, featuring a Coles supermarket and many retailers, is nearby. The smaller Coolibah Plaza, offering a Farmer Jacks supermarket and assorted cafés, is also within easy reach.
Which parks are within a short distance of the property?
Within roughly 1‑1.5 km you’ll find Bindaree Rotary Park, Lenham Park, Mereworth Park, Sarre Park and Cabrini Park, providing plenty of green space for walks and recreation.
Are there any sporting or recreational facilities close to the home?
Warwick Stadium, a multi‑sport venue, lies about 1.3 km away, and Penistone Reserve, used for cricket, football and other activities, is also nearby, offering a range of community sport options.
